

While her frontal and citadel armor are good, her side armor is weak enough to take devastating damage from enemy salvos if presented broadside. If forced to go toe-to-toe with another battleship, she must use her superior speed to control the engagement, unique turtle-back armor style to mitigate damage, and employ her torpedoes for punishing strikes. She is also adept at engaging distracted or over-extended battleships. Scharnhorst performs very well as a cruiser hunter or destroyer killer her undersized shells will not over-penetrate as often, allowing for increased damage output per salvo against light-skinned targets. Her unique traits present her with a plethora of roles to play. These disparities set her clearly apart from from her Tier VII counterparts and sister-ship Gneisenau.

Her characteristics are very cruiser-like: top speed above 30 knots with a decent rudder shift time, plus a smaller-caliber main battery than other battleships that trades alpha damage and penetration for good rate of fire and muzzle velocity.
